Frascold launches semi-hermetic ammonia compressor

Italian compressor manufacturer Frascold has launched a new semi-hermetic ammonia screw compressor range called “Aluminium”.

The range was developed to meet the storage and freezing needs of large and medium-sized industries, operating in a temperature range between +5°C and -40°C (such as for the food, chemical and pharmaceutical industries), where ammonia plays a central role.

The range has been named Aluminium because that is the metal used in the compressor motor. Frascold says copper and its alloys are vulnerable to corrosion in the event of contact with ammonia.

“The adoption of aluminium combined with permanent magnets marks a significant step in terms of chemical resistance and operational continuity over time,” says the company.

The eight models available, for both low (ALU-L) and medium temperature (ALU-H) applications, allow a volumetric displacement between 315 and 470 m³/h at 50 Hz and between 378 and 564 m³/h at 60 Hz. The motor power ranges between 130 and 160 HP equivalent to 97–120 kW, operating in a wide frequency range from 30 to 60 Hz.

The sizing pressure reaches 20.5 bar on the low pressure side and 30 bar on the high pressure side, while the maximum discharge temperature is 90°C. The evaporation temperatures also highlight the considerable application flexibility of the range, extending from -45°C to -10°C for the low (LT) and from -20°C to +5°C for the medium temperature (MT). 

The balancing and integration of the motor inside the compressor also reduces noise emissions, and the integration between variable frequency drive (VFD) and variable internal volume control (Vi) allows for optimised operating performance.
